Jun 2007 - Charlotte Strodl - Background release
Charlotte Strodl was born in London in 1983. At an early age it was apparent that she was to become another exceptional artist to come out of the Strodl family. Throughout her school years she won numerous art prizes as she experimented with different mediums, eventually settling on fine art where she excelled. With a strong academic head on her shoulders, Charlotte decided to go to Exeter University to study Business in 2002. With a business degree under her belt and a heated passion for fashion, Charlotte headed back to London to immerse herself in the exhilarating world of fashion PR. She began her career at Jimmy Choo before moving to top fashion and beauty PR agency Modus Publicity: which boasts infamous clients such as Calvin Klein, Etro and Hamish Morrow. Amongst the many designer brands, Strodl became entranced by the beautiful jewellery collections of Lara Boinc, Levieve and Boucheron. With the heavy price tags, Charlotte could not afford to purchase any so following travels to Asia she began to design her own jewellery using semi precious gems and freshwater pearls sourced from there. After her own jewellery started to get noticed by people in the business and even on the street and in clubs, Charlotte thought she might be on to something. She cemented her talent with a jewellery design and jewellery business course at Central St Martins School of Art and then put her creative and business skills into action. Slowly but surely, a jewellery collection was born. Using the finest gold filled and sterling silver chains, Charlotte makes each piece by hand capturing her vision and passion in each and every one. With the debut collection already causing a stir, Rockabella jewellery looks set to become an identifiable and unique thread in London’s rich fashion tapestry.
